Understanding the SZR Internet City Jebel Ali Corridor Value
The stretch from Sheikh Zayed Road through Internet City to Jebel Ali isn't just any commuter route. This corridor connects Dubai's financial district, its technology hub, and the region's largest free zone, creating a concentrated pathway where business decision-makers, C-suite executives, and industry professionals spend 45-90 minutes daily during their commutes.
Traffic data from Dubai's Road and Transport Authority indicates that this route sees over 275,000 vehicles daily, with peak concentration between 7:00-9:30 AM and 5:30-8:00 PM. What makes lamp post advertising particularly effective here is the stop-and-go nature of traffic during these hours. Unlike highway billboards that blur past at 120 km/h, lamp posts positioned at traffic lights, roundabouts, and congestion points receive extended viewing time, with some measurements showing 8-12 second exposure periods per lamp post.
A financial services firm running a recruitment campaign discovered that their lamp post placements near Internet City metro station generated 156% more website visits than their comparable billboard spend on the same route. The difference came down to proximity and frequency. While their billboard appeared once along the route, their lamp post network of 24 units created 24 individual touchpoints, each reinforcing the message.
Media buying strategies that incorporate lamp post networks benefit from cumulative frequency. A commuter traveling this route five days weekly encounters the same lamp post advertising message 40 times monthly, creating the repetition that drives brand recall without the premium costs associated with prime billboard locations.
ROI Metrics That Changed Outdoor Media Planning
When a luxury automotive brand allocated 30% of their outdoor budget to lamp post advertising along this corridor, they implemented QR codes on each unit to track direct engagement. The results challenged conventional assumptions about outdoor media measurement. Their lamp post campaign generated 2,847 direct scans over eight weeks, with 43% of those scans occurring during evening commute hours between 6:00-7:30 PM.
The cost per engagement for their lamp post network came to AED 127, compared to AED 394 for their billboard placements on the same route. More significantly, 28% of lamp post engagements converted to showroom appointments, compared to 11% from billboard-driven traffic. The proximity factor played a crucial role. Lamp posts positioned within 500 meters of their Dubai Hills showroom generated 64% higher conversion rates than units positioned further along the route.
A technology solutions provider took a different measurement approach for their lamp post campaign targeting Jebel Ali Free Zone companies. They used unique landing page URLs on different lamp post clusters to track geographic response patterns. Units positioned at Jebel Ali Industrial Area roundabouts generated 3.2 times more B2B leads than their premium billboard at Internet City, despite costing 70% less for the campaign period.

Strategic Placement Success Stories
The most successful lamp post campaigns along this corridor share common strategic elements. A telecommunications provider discovered that clustering lamp posts at decision points rather than spreading them evenly produced superior results. They positioned 18 lamp posts within a 2-kilometer stretch approaching Jebel Ali Free Zone entrance gates, creating a "message corridor" that built anticipation and reinforced their value proposition through repeated exposure in a concentrated timeframe.
Their campaign targeting logistics companies achieved a 23% response rate to their limited-time offer, directly attributable to the saturation strategy that made their brand impossible to ignore during the final approach to the free zone. The campaign ROI reached 290%, with customer acquisition costs 40% lower than their digital advertising running concurrently.
Internet City's unique demographic concentration of tech professionals and creative agencies makes lamp post positioning around this district particularly valuable for B2B services. A cloud services company placed 12 lamp posts on roundabouts and intersections within a 1-kilometer radius of Internet City metro station. Their targeting strategy focused on the "last mile" of the commute, when professionals are mentally transitioning from commute mode to work mode.
By featuring a simple message about productivity solutions with a memorable domain name, they achieved 847 direct website visits tracked through their campaign-specific URL over six weeks. Their conversion rate from this traffic reached 19%, substantially higher than their 7% conversion rate from LinkedIn advertising targeting similar professionals. The physical proximity to their prospect's workplace created a psychological association that digital channels couldn't replicate.

Maximizing Campaign Performance Through Smart Planning
The most cost-effective lamp post campaigns along this corridor follow several proven principles. Seasonal timing matters significantly. October through April sees increased traffic volumes as tourism peaks and business activity intensifies following summer slowdowns. A retail brand achieved 35% higher engagement rates for their lamp post campaign launched in November compared to a similar campaign in July.
Message simplification proves critical. Lamp posts with seven words or fewer outperform detailed messaging by significant margins. A insurance provider testing two creative approaches found their simple "Insure Your Future. Call Now." message generated 58% more enquiries than their detailed benefits-focused creative on identical lamp post placements.
Sequential messaging across multiple lamp posts creates narrative engagement. A real estate developer used a series of lamp posts approaching their project site with progressive messages: lamp post one featured their logo and "Coming Soon," lamp post two highlighted "Luxury Living," lamp post three stated "Show Home Open," and lamp post four provided directions. This sequence generated 23% more showroom visits than their previous single-message approach.
